Writers and other artists are particularly hard hit these days. Most don’t qualify for government assistance. Many have no income right now at all.

Enter the Dramatists Guild Fund. In good times, they help writers bring their stories to life on stage. Now, they are providing emergency financial assistance to individual playwrights, composers, lyricists, and librettists in dire need of funds due to severe hardship or unexpected illness.

And enter INSIDER TRACKS.

INSIDER TRACKS offer an easy and fun way for you to help writers and for writers to help writers - many of whom don’t have the financial resources for charitable giving.

INSIDER TRACKS are songs you wouldn’t normally have access to. They’re not on albums or iTunes. Maybe they’re “demos” - written during development of a musical, or for a cabaret show, or preparatory to an album. Either way, they are fantastic songs. That you now get to hear (you Insider, you). And, you get to meet talented writers you might not otherwise know. Another benefit: you’re helping their careers.

Most importantly, all proceeds go to the DGF emergency grants (minus processing fees).
